Transaction 15f75e37571145f53079a0d41d7905801f6e62253aa69513ca6e919747ba4fcb
1 Input
1 Output
-
15f75e37571145f53079a0d41d7905801f6e62253aa69513ca6e919747ba4fcb:0
- value
- 100669
- script pubkey
- OP_0 OP_PUSHBYTES_32 21791cbca52c82d89fd891b562a7f954e056136c2197d343197d2f12ac865e62
- address
- bc1qy9u3e0999jpd387cjx6k9fle2ns9vymvyxtaxsce05h39tyxte3qruphy8